// Copyright (C) 2026 COOLJAPAN OU (Team KitaSan)
// SPDX-License-Identifier: Apache-2.0

//! HMAC-like asset pack signing using SHA-256 double-hash construction.
//!
//! Signing scheme: `SHA256(key || SHA256(message))` — length-extension resistant.

#![allow(dead_code)]

use anyhow::{bail, Context, Result};
use sha2::{Digest, Sha256};
use std::path::Path;

// ── Public structs ────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────

/// Signature metadata for a signed pack.
pub struct PackSignature {
    /// Format version — currently 1.
    pub version: u32,
    /// Algorithm identifier, e.g. "sha256-chain".
    pub algorithm: String,
    /// Raw 32-byte signature.
    pub signature: Vec<u8>,
    /// Unix timestamp in seconds (0 for deterministic tests).
    pub timestamp: u64,
    /// Identifies who signed the pack.
    pub signer_id: String,
}

/// A manifest hash paired with its signature.
pub struct SignedPack {
    /// SHA-256 of sorted manifest content.
    pub manifest_hash: Vec<u8>,
    /// The signature covering `manifest_hash`.
    pub signature: PackSignature,
}

// ── Core crypto primitive ─────────────────────────────────────────────────────

/// `SHA256(key || SHA256(message))` — length-extension resistant double-hash.
pub fn double_hash_sign(key: &[u8], message: &[u8]) -> Vec<u8> {
    // Inner hash: SHA256(message)
    let mut inner = Sha256::new();
    inner.update(message);
    let inner_hash = inner.finalize();

    // Outer hash: SHA256(key || inner_hash)
    let mut outer = Sha256::new();
    outer.update(key);
    outer.update(inner_hash);
    outer.finalize().to_vec()
}

// ── Manifest hash ─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────

/// Compute SHA-256 over sorted `"path:sha256hex"` lines for all files in `dir`.
pub fn pack_manifest_hash(dir: &Path) -> Result<Vec<u8>> {
    let mut entries: Vec<(String, String)> = Vec::new();
    collect_manifest_entries(dir, dir, &mut entries)?;
    entries.sort_by(|a, b| a.0.cmp(&b.0));

    let mut hasher = Sha256::new();
    for (rel_path, sha_hex) in &entries {
        let line = format!("{}:{}\n", rel_path, sha_hex);
        hasher.update(line.as_bytes());
    }
    Ok(hasher.finalize().to_vec())
}

fn collect_manifest_entries(
    root: &Path,
    current: &Path,
    out: &mut Vec<(String, String)>,
) -> Result<()> {
    for entry in
        std::fs::read_dir(current).with_context(|| format!("reading dir {}", current.display()))?
    {
        let entry = entry.with_context(|| "dir entry error")?;
        let path = entry.path();
        if path.is_dir() {
            collect_manifest_entries(root, &path, out)?;
        } else {
            let data =
                std::fs::read(&path).with_context(|| format!("reading {}", path.display()))?;
            let sha_hex = sha256_hex(&data);
            let rel = path
                .strip_prefix(root)
                .with_context(|| "strip prefix")?
                .to_string_lossy()
                .replace('\\', "/");
            out.push((rel, sha_hex));
        }
    }
    Ok(())
}

fn sha256_hex(data: &[u8]) -> String {
    let mut h = Sha256::new();
    h.update(data);
    hex::encode(h.finalize())
}

// ── Sign / verify ─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────

/// Sign all files in `dir` and return a `SignedPack`.
pub fn sign_pack_dir(dir: &Path, key: &[u8], signer_id: &str) -> Result<SignedPack> {
    let manifest_hash = pack_manifest_hash(dir)?;
    let signature_bytes = double_hash_sign(key, &manifest_hash);

    Ok(SignedPack {
        manifest_hash: manifest_hash.clone(),
        signature: PackSignature {
            version: 1,
            algorithm: "sha256-chain".to_string(),
            signature: signature_bytes,
            timestamp: 0,
            signer_id: signer_id.to_string(),
        },
    })
}

/// Verify a `SignedPack` against the current state of `dir` using `key`.
pub fn verify_pack_signature(dir: &Path, signed: &SignedPack, key: &[u8]) -> bool {
    let current_hash = match pack_manifest_hash(dir) {
        Ok(h) => h,
        Err(_) => return false,
    };
    if current_hash != signed.manifest_hash {
        return false;
    }
    let expected_sig = double_hash_sign(key, &current_hash);
    expected_sig == signed.signature.signature
}

// ── Hex encoding ──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────

/// Hex-encode the signature bytes.
pub fn signature_to_hex(sig: &PackSignature) -> String {
    hex::encode(&sig.signature)
}

/// Decode a hex signature string back into a `PackSignature`.
pub fn signature_from_hex(
    hex_str: &str,
    version: u32,
    algorithm: &str,
    timestamp: u64,
    signer_id: &str,
) -> Result<PackSignature> {
    let bytes = hex::decode(hex_str).with_context(|| "hex decode failed")?;
    if bytes.len() != 32 {
        bail!("signature must be exactly 32 bytes, got {}", bytes.len());
    }
    Ok(PackSignature {
        version,
        algorithm: algorithm.to_string(),
        signature: bytes,
        timestamp,
        signer_id: signer_id.to_string(),
    })
}

// ── File I/O ──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────

/// Write a `SignedPack` to a text file in simple key=value format.
pub fn write_signature_file(signed: &SignedPack, path: &Path) -> Result<()> {
    let sig = &signed.signature;
    let content = format!(
        "version={}\nalgorithm={}\ntimestamp={}\nsigner_id={}\nmanifest_hash={}\nsignature={}\n",
        sig.version,
        sig.algorithm,
        sig.timestamp,
        sig.signer_id,
        hex::encode(&signed.manifest_hash),
        signature_to_hex(sig),
    );
    std::fs::write(path, content)
        .with_context(|| format!("writing signature file {}", path.display()))?;
    Ok(())
}

/// Read a `SignedPack` from a text file written by `write_signature_file`.
pub fn read_signature_file(path: &Path) -> Result<SignedPack> {
    let content = std::fs::read_to_string(path)
        .with_context(|| format!("reading signature file {}", path.display()))?;

    let mut version: Option<u32> = None;
    let mut algorithm: Option<String> = None;
    let mut timestamp: Option<u64> = None;
    let mut signer_id: Option<String> = None;
    let mut manifest_hash_hex: Option<String> = None;
    let mut signature_hex: Option<String> = None;

    for line in content.lines() {
        let line = line.trim();
        if line.is_empty() {
            continue;
        }
        let (k, v) = line
            .split_once('=')
            .with_context(|| format!("malformed line: {}", line))?;
        match k {
            "version" => version = Some(v.parse().with_context(|| "parsing version")?),
            "algorithm" => algorithm = Some(v.to_string()),
            "timestamp" => timestamp = Some(v.parse().with_context(|| "parsing timestamp")?),
            "signer_id" => signer_id = Some(v.to_string()),
            "manifest_hash" => manifest_hash_hex = Some(v.to_string()),
            "signature" => signature_hex = Some(v.to_string()),
            _ => bail!("unknown key: {}", k),
        }
    }

    let version = version.with_context(|| "missing version")?;
    let algorithm = algorithm.with_context(|| "missing algorithm")?;
    let timestamp = timestamp.with_context(|| "missing timestamp")?;
    let signer_id = signer_id.with_context(|| "missing signer_id")?;
    let manifest_hash_hex = manifest_hash_hex.with_context(|| "missing manifest_hash")?;
    let signature_hex = signature_hex.with_context(|| "missing signature")?;

    let manifest_hash =
        hex::decode(&manifest_hash_hex).with_context(|| "hex decode manifest_hash")?;
    let signature_bytes = hex::decode(&signature_hex).with_context(|| "hex decode signature")?;

    Ok(SignedPack {
        manifest_hash,
        signature: PackSignature {
            version,
            algorithm,
            signature: signature_bytes,
            timestamp,
            signer_id,
        },
    })
}
